The Doors Vinyl Box [180 Gram Vinyl]
: :The ultimate collectible: a limited edition (12,500 copies worldwide), 7-disc vinyl box covered in faux lizard skin with 12-inch 180-gram HQ vinyl re-issues of the original stereo mixes of the band's six Morrison-era studio albums, plus a copy of the '67 debut ('The Doors') in mono. Includes 'The Doors', 'Strange Days', 'Waiting For The Sun', 'The Soft Parade', 'Morrison Hotel', and 'LA Woman'.

The Long Road Home: 1963-2003
:Album Description:Subtitled - The 40th Anniversary Collection. A six CD retrospective covering their 40 year career (1963-2003). Discs one through five feature studio recordings that include classic tracks, B-sides, album tracks, rare foreign releases, & six previously unreleased tracks, 'She Said Yeah', 'Listen To Me' (Demo), 'So Lonely' (Demo), 'Bring Back Your Love To Me' (Demo), 'A Taste Of Honey', & 'Can't Lie No More'. Platinum: A Life in Music
: :The four-CD box-set Platinum was released to commemorate the 20th anniversary of Elvis's death. While much of the material here is made up of familiar hits, there are also 77 unreleased performances spread over the set. Of course, unreleased doesn't necessarily mean better. The original versions of 'Heartbreak Hotel,' 'Rip It Up,' and 'That's All Right' are so firmly embedded as the foundations of rock & roll that the new versions here add little luster. Essential Collection: 1965-1997
: :The sprawling suburbs that sprang up south of Los Angeles during the postwar industrial boom gave white pop two of its most accomplished icons, Brian Wilson's Beach Boys, out of Hawthorne, and Downey's Carpenters. That geography subtly permeates the first disc of this four-CD, 89-track anthology, from the living room demos and indie singles that pushed them to a Hollywood Bowl battle of the bands victory while still teens to their first triumphs for A&M Records, just across town in Hollywood.
